Al-Jaafari: The necessity to put an end to the economic terrorism represented by the unilateral coercive measures imposed on Syria

New York-SANA

Syria's permanent delegate to the United Nations, Dr. Bashar Jaafari, stressed the need to put an end to the economic, commercial, financial and health terrorism that unilateral coercive measures imposed by Western countries on Syria imply, noting that achieving any improvement in the humanitarian situation requires cooperation and coordination with the Syrian state and refraining from politicizing humanitarian work These states' abandonment of their policies based on the imposition of coercive measures and preconditions for humanitarian and development work.

Al-Jaafari indicated during a video session of the Security Council today via video on the humanitarian situation in Syria that Syria has recently, at one time or another, in cooperation with a number of other UN member states, to send official letters and appeals to the Secretary-General of the United Nations and successive Security Council heads to demand action to raise These illegal economic coercive measures imposed by the member states of this organization on the Syrian people and a number of friendly peoples, pointing out that these calls received a positive resonance from the Secretary-General and a number of senior officials of the organization, including the special envoy to Syria, Pederson and the Special Rapporteur on the effects of coercive measures on human rights and the Special Rapporteur on the right to food, the World Health Organization and others more than forty UN organizations demanding an end to coercive unilateral measures suffered by nearly two billion people of the population of the affected countries, including and international.

Al-Jaafari pointed out that, in exchange for these positions, the American administration and its allies preferred to persist in their violations of international law, the United Nations Charter and human rights instruments and have intent during the past two months to thwart any initiatives or draft resolutions that include demanding an end to the negative effects of unilateral coercive measures on the ability to address the health sector And service in the countries targeted by the Corona epidemic, and not only that, but the American administration announced the extension of unilateral unjust sanctions imposed on the Syrian people, striking a wall with international law and the United Nations Charter Decisions and calls for all to put an end to these procedures in the position represents a new step in the hostile policies towards Syria refutes any humanitarian allegations promoted by the administration and its allies on the tongues of their representatives in the United Nations and beyond.

Al-Jaafari clarified that Syria has repeatedly informed the Security Council over the past years of the catastrophic effects of coercive economic measures on the daily life of 24 million Syrians and the ability of state institutions and the health, economic and service sectors in Syria to carry out its tasks in an optimal manner. The Corona epidemic has increased the magnitude of the burdens and challenges that These measures represent and once again highlight the allegations promoted by some western countries, which have recently refused even to allow Syrian planes to return the Syrian citizens stranded in some European countries to their homeland, as the clarifications issued by the The European Commission recently on coercive measures to demonstrate once again that these actions only harm people and to confirm the non-intention of these countries to lift these measures that lack any acceptable moral, economic or political basis, calling on the Security Council to instruct the General Secretariat to submit a comprehensive report within a period not exceeding thirty days On the catastrophic effects of these measures on the Syrian people.

Al-Jaafari pointed out that the coercive measures imposed by the European Union and the United States are illegal, which is an attempt to circumvent the legitimacy of the Security Council and aims to undermine the sovereignty of the Syrian state, stating that the prospects for European and American humanitarian and medical supplies to Syria are at zero levels due to the imposition of a wide range of restrictions and preconditions for these and that supplies all promoted by Western countries that impose coercive measures on Syria is only a desperate attempt new "to humanize" the brutal behavior of terrorism and
economic and collective punishment practiced against the Syrian people , but Syria will not Delude claims these countries will never succumb to its dictates.

Al-Jaafari reaffirmed Syria's position on the Brussels donor conferences that these conferences are merely publicity and promotional activities aimed at serving the agendas of the governments of some of the organized countries and participating in them in the politicization of humanitarian work and the imposition of their politicized conditions, stressing that Syria does not recognize any meetings or initiatives held around it without their participation and full coordination With it and renews its demand by the United Nations not to participate in such conferences in order to preserve the integrity of its role and respect for humanitarian standards.

Al-Jaafari indicated that the Turkish occupation forces in northwestern Syria and the American occupation forces in northeastern Syria and in the Al-Tanf region in which the Rakban camp is located continue to support terrorist organizations and their separatist militia, which was confirmed by the confessions of a number of terrorists affiliated with ISIS who fell into the grip The Syrian Arab Army recently confirmed that they received training at the hands of the terrorist organization “Commandos of the Revolution” under the supervision of the American occupation forces in Al-Tanf, pointing out that all this is being done in light of the silence applied by the Security Council in which some permanent members seek to make it a platform for NATO and a shadow. Al-Jaafari pointed out that the Turkish regime again violates its obligations under international law and agreements governing international water and rivers by constructing the "Elisu" dam on the course of the Tigris River and starting to fill the industrial dam lake, which will deprive millions of Syrians and Iraqis for years of benefiting from the water of the Tigris River and continues to use Water as a weapon against Syrian civilians in the city of Hasaka and the neighboring population centers, where it once again cut water from the Alouk station to deprive a million Syrians of drinking water, which is a prescribed war crime and a crime against humanity calling for emergency meetings of the Security Council to end them and not War criminals accountable in the Turkish regime on them instead of blind to these crimes and emergency sessions held one after the other on fabricated and artificial issues.

Al-Jaafari pointed out that the American occupation forces prevented the work of the Syrian Arab Red Crescent in the regions of northeastern Syria and sought to replace it with illegal organizations that are not recognized by the International Federation of Red Cross and Red Crescent Societies, and the Turkish regime also sent the Turkish Red Crescent to operate in the areas it occupies in the north and northwest Syria and preventing the Syrian Arab Red Crescent from working in it and attacking its headquarters and looting and attacking its employees, and this is similar to what the Israeli occupation has done since its occupation of the Syrian Golan in 1967 to settle the Israeli and Turkish occupation in violation of the decisions of the conference Cisse International Federation of Red Cross and Red Crescent Societies.

Al-Jaafari said that what is worse is that the Turkish regime has pitted its terrorist organizations against the Syrian Arab Red Crescent and urged them to prevent humanitarian access from the inside to create pretexts for extending the work across the border, which is a customary practice that we and our humanitarian partners have previously seen in a number of regions, including the eastern regions And southern countries with the aim of granting excuses to extend work across the borders and to facilitate the smuggling of weapons, equipment and supplies to terrorist organizations, stressing Syria's position rejecting cross-border work and its demand once again to close the OCHA office in Gaziantep, which has made itself a tool for terrorist organizations and for For anti-Syrian countries and a bugle for lies and a platform for misleading the Security Council and world public opinion, stressing that achieving any improvement in the humanitarian situation requires full cooperation and full coordination with the Syrian state and refraining from politicizing humanitarian work and the reluctance of Western countries from their policies based on the imposition of coercive measures and preconditions and loyalties to humanitarian and development work .
